2009年11月26日 (木)

GooglePhone HT-03A

オークションで白ロムHT-03Aを20,500円で競り落とした。
用途はアプリ開発用で既にiappli携帯潮汐をandroidに移植済だ!
早速、USB接続モードでデバックしたが「予期せず停止しました。やり直して下さい。」とのエラー発生、HalloWorldはうまくいくのに何故でしょう!

-覚書-

作成したアプリをHT-03Aでデバッグ方法
1.先ず、HT-03AをUSBデバッグ有効にする。
[Home]->[menu]->[設定]->[アプリケーション]->[開発]->[USBデバッグ]

2.HT-03A付属のUSBケーブルで、PCとHT-03Aを接続し、SDKのUSBドライバをインストールする。
ドライバーはandroid-sdk-windowsフォルダーにある。
(64ビット)usb-draiver/amd64
(32ビット)usb-draiver/x86

3.これでPCを再起動するとSKDのAndroid Device ChooserにHT-03Aが表示される。

| | コメント (0) | トラックバック (0)

2009年11月10日 (火)

「携帯潮汐」紹介ブログ

自作のケータイアプリで人気No.1は「携帯潮汐」だ!
利用者は釣り師とサーファー、自分はどっちもやらないので使ってない。
ブロガーの皆様、紹介記事ありがとうございます。
一魚一会(2009.11.10)
ハイド ライダーズ BLOG(2009.08.01)
Wellcom to my blog(2009.05.18)
M@sh's MovableType (2009.04.12)
えんたか!フィッシングワールド(磯・堤防釣り)(2009.03.08)
lurelife(2009.02.15)
『TEAMがっくし。』シーバス釣行 オフィシャル ブログ(2009.01.26)
ナッキーの不定期日記(2008.10.01)
イカ・・・なんとか(2008.08.27)
釣れない日記(2008.08.15)
Weekend Seabass Life Blog(2008.06.24)
Anglers house(2008.06.04)
パパ大好き(2008.02.21)
おもしろいもの見っけた!(2008.02.06)
water melon.のエギング日記(2008.01.18)
feel so good(2007.09.02)
山梨のイカ釣り師の釣り日記(2007.08.07)
のめりこみやすく飽きやすいびんちゃんのブログ(2007.06.30)
しんぺーなブログ(2007.03.07)
手のヒラアジのメッキ道鍛錬中(2007.03.02)
疑似餌釣りに魅せられて・・・(2007.01.09)
ir de pesca(2005.12.11)

| | コメント (0) | トラックバック (0)

2009年9月18日 (金)

Google Android版「携帯潮汐」

Ktide_ht03a Google AndroidケータイdocomoHT-03A版の「携帯潮汐」がエミュレータレベルでほぼ完成した。
Androidは言語はJavaなので移植は比較的簡単だ!
仮想マシンがJava MEでなく、独自のDalvik仮想マシンを採用している。

開発環境はAndoroid入門を参照させて頂いて構築した。
実機は持ってないので実機テストが出来ず公開が出来ない。

| | コメント (0) | トラックバック (0)

2009年7月18日 (土)

Skype for W-ZERO3

Skype_wzero3 パソコン体験講座でSkypeをやることになった。
もちろんメーンはWindowsパソコンであるが携帯端末もあった方が便利だろうと眠っていたW-ZERO3を引っ張り出した。
このマシンは無線LAN、マイク、スピーカー内蔵なので付属品が不要だ!

早速、下記を参考にさせて頂いた。
http://wiki.wince.ne.jp/W-ZERO3es/?Skype%20for%20Pocket%20PC

1.WindowsMobile用をW-ZERO3で下記からをダウンロード
http://www.skype.com/intl/ja/download/skype/windowsmobile/
2. .cabファイルを、W-ZERO3[es]のエクスプローラーからタップして実行
3.「デバイス」を選択し、本体のメモリにインストール

結果、オーライ!W-ZERO3が生き返った。
これ、いい!無線LANがあればWillcomとの契約なしで電話が出来る。
最新機adovanced W-ZERO3[es]が欲しくなった。

| | コメント (0) | トラックバック (2)

2009年5月23日 (土)

docomo DojaからStarへの移植

iアプリコンテンツ開発ダイドfor Star-1.x詳細編」によると

StarプロファイルとDojaプロファイルではソースコードレベルでの互換性がありません。
この互換性の問題に対応するため、今後当面の期間において、Star対応電話にもDojaアプリケーション実行環境が搭載されます。
Dojaアプリケーション実行環境は、将来的にはStar対応電話には搭載されなくなる可能性があります。
とのことだ!

SH-03A以降、Dojaで横画面表示が出来ないのはその兆候の現われか?
横表示はStarでないと出来ないとのことでStar開発環境を構築することにした。

(1)事前にSUNサイトにあるJ2SDK1.4.2をインストール
(2)次にDoCoMoのiappliを作ろうのiαppli Development Kit for DoJa5.0をインストールでQVGA開発は出来る
(3)そしていつも忘れてしまうMath関数用のToolkMASCOT CAPSULE Toolkit for DoCoMoのLibralyのMascot Capsule V3 dll for Doja5.0/5.1/Star1.0からダウンロードしたmicro3d_v3_32.dllをiDKStar1.0/binフォルダに入れる

DojaからStarへの移植は下記が相違するだけで比較的簡単だ!

・import com.nttdocomo.ui.*; → import com.docomostar.ui.*;に変更
・IApplication → StarApplicationに変更
・void start() → void started(int launchType)に変更
・待ち受け機能なし
・FONTサイズ指定はTINY,SMALE,MEDIUM,LARGE → 12,16,24,30,32,48,60に変更
・ShortTimerはTimerに変更
・media関連は import com.docomostar.media.*;パッケージ
・デフォルト画面サイズ240×240→480×480
・SOFT_KEY3/4(全角4文字)/SELECT_KEY(全角2文字)追加
・アプリの終了はStarApplication.getThisStarApplication().terminate();

そんなわけで移植第一弾「横型潮汐ワイド」完成!

| | コメント (0) | トラックバック (0)

2009年5月18日 (月)

ケータイ機種依存情報(追加)

(6)SH-03A以降の横画面表示
SH-04Aで潮汐ワイドの横表示avetidew854480がダウンロード出来ないとの報告があった。
mojiEditによるとDojaでのSH03A以降は横画面表示が駄目なようだ!
横画面表示はStarで対応のようだ。

(5)Doja5.0ソフトキーラベル非表示
ソフトキーラベル非表示のsetSoftLabelVisibleはDoja5.0からとなっているのでコンパイルOKだが、N903i,N904には非搭載?、この命令を実行するとエラー!実質Doja5.1からだ!
「Doja5.xプロファイル対応iモード携帯電話各機種オプションAPI・拡張API実装状況」
実際、Doja5.0対応機でソフトキー非表示にする必要な機種はないんだけどDoja5.1のアプリを共通化しているもんで・・・

(4)D905i擬似GIF非対応!
ケータイ内のデータを外に出す制限は厳しい!
唯一許されているのがマイドキュメントだ!
そこでデータバックアップの手法としてデータを擬似画像にして保存する方法がとられる。
・擬似GIF;自作アプリに搭載していたがD905で対応せず
・擬似JPG;D905で対応

(3)auオープンアプリ2468キーが方向キーとして反応
auオープンアプリ「携帯潮汐」で2キー(+1分)を押したら月がー1されるとの不具合報告があった。
DoCoMoケータイではそんな現象は発生しない!
なかなか、原因解らず・・・・・
月がー1されるケースは↑キーを押した時、ここで閃いたのが(↑)、(←)、(→)、(↓)そして(Enter)?だ!
MIDP Javaでは数字キーを先に判定してelseだったら方向キーを判定するのが常識なのだそうだ!

(2)DoCoMo M702iS(Motorola)
Doja-4.0LEなれどimport com.nttdocomo.opt.ui.j3d.Math;のMath非搭載?
具体的にはsinやsqrtがあると「アプリケーションエラー」が発生
自作のsinやsqrtに置き換えたら動作した。

mixiで教えて貰った機種依存の確認方法
try
 {
  Class.forName("com.nttdocomo.opt.ui.j3d.Math");
 }
 catch(ClassNotFoundException e){}

(1)SoftBank 804NK(nokia)
MIDP2.0であるがサウンドファイルの再生が不可?
具体的にはplayerを削除したら動作した。

|

2009年4月 1日 (水)

旧暦六曜Javaソースプログラム公開!

携帯潮汐に組込んでいたDoja iappli版「旧暦六曜Javaソースプログラム」を要望が多い?ので公開する。

本プログラムの原典は高野英明氏の開発されたjgAWK版「旧暦計算サンプルプログラム」でこれをiappli Doja版に移植したものです。
内容を理解せずに移植しているので計算結果は責任が持てません!

従って、本プログラムの著作権は原典のjgAWK版「旧暦計算サンプルプログラム」を開発された高野英明氏に帰属します。
上記のリンクより高野氏の「QRSAMP」を取得し、そのドキュメント内に書かれている再配布規定に従って下さい。

| | コメント (0) | トラックバック (0)

2008年12月31日 (水)

iappli横画面化推進!

DisplayArea指定で簡単に横画面化が可能なことがわかったので横画面対応アプリを追加した。

潮汐ワイド
横表示で一週間表示が楽々可能
Avetidew
携帯潮汐
横表示で時間軸表示の拡大
Avektide
PassWordBox
横表示でパスワードの桁数増加に対応
Password
車燃費
横表示でフォントサイズ拡大が可能
Nenpi

| | コメント (0) | トラックバック (0)

2008年12月24日 (水)

ケータイアプリ自作の歩み(WVGA化)

ケータイにアプリ搭載、開発言語がSL Zaurusと同じJavaだ!ということで飛びついた。
だが互換はない!ケータイ同士でもDoCoMoとVodafone/auでは違う。
更にケータイJavaは進化( Dojaの進化MIDPの進化 )し続けている。
進化が早くてアプリ開発は大変なのだ!
反面、それを追っかけていればアプリの機能も自然とアップするので楽しい。
一番の悩みは動作確認だ!実機はDoCoMoを1台しか持ってないこと。
他キャリアケータイ用アプリは動作確認に協力してくれることを条件に移植する。D905i

今度、DoCoMoケータイで最大画面のWVGA480x864のD905iを購入した。
これで今後自作アプリのWVGA化を進める。
画像で動作しているアプリは第一作横表示の「潮汐ワイド」です。

アプリ名 Doja MIDP
1.0 2.0 3.0 4.0 5.0 1.0 2.0
503 504 505
900
700
901
703
903
W
V
G
A
auSi
通常
Si
高細度
au
オプン
Si
3G他
*
Si
W
V
G
A
似々Ⅱ - - - - - -
TextBoxDBs - - - - - -
お年玉 - - - - - -
歩日記 - - - - - -
被写界深度 - - - - - -
PassWordBox - -
車燃費 - - - - -
ダイエット - - - - -
csvStation - - - - - - -
txtStation - - - - - - - -
LapTime - - - - - - - -
携帯潮汐 - -
日の出月の出 - - - - - - - -
潮汐ワイド - - - - - -

*Si3G,Willcomケータイ,W-ZERO3,M1000,N7xxNK

| | コメント (51) | トラックバック (0)

2008年12月19日 (金)

簡単だった!iappli横表示

20081219170113 20081219170223 iアプリWVGAの横表示はDrawAreaの指定だけでいいんですね!
縦表示;DrawArea = 480x854
横表示;DrawArea = 854x480

これまで90度回転フォントを作って内蔵していたのだ!
http://yamatonoie.cocolog-nifty.com/ave/2007/12/wvga_478a.html

| | コメント (0) | トラックバック (0)

より以前の記事一覧